A successful Grain Bin Floor begins with exact loading reckoning found on anticipate grain type, storage duration, and container dimensions. Different grains - such as wheat, corn, or soybeans - exert varying pressures due to density and moisture message. Overestimating or underestimating load capacity can lead to previous failure, making precise technology essential. Material pick significantly influences seniority and performance. Concrete floors offer exceptional strength and fire resistance but require proper reinforcement to keep break under cyclic loading. Steel decks provide lightweight tractability and fast installation but requirement rich corrosion protection through galvanization or epoxy coatings. Composite shock system combine strength with rock-bottom weight, proffer excellent resistivity to moisture and chemicals while back mod automation need. Effective drain is non-negotiable. Without proper incline and drain footpath, stand h2o promotes mold growth, accelerates metallic erosion, and increases freeze-thaw damage danger. Designer should control a minimal 1 - 2 % side toward discharge points, complemented by strategically placed weep holes or drain channels integrated into the floor structure. Surface texture play a vital persona in both guard and efficiency. A smooth surface may trim rubble but increase slip luck during wet conditions. Textured finishes or employ anti-slip coatings improve traction without compromise grain flowing, balancing operational safety with functional performance. Regular review and proactive maintenance extend floor life. Cracks, spawl, or localised erosion should be doctor immediately to prevent water infiltration and structural weakening. Implementing a scheduled maintenance programme help detect issues before they intensify, preserving base integrity and useable persistence.
